Il volume è un importante strumento per comprendere tutte le regole fiscali che devono essere osservate per la corretta deducibilità dei costi di acquisizione e di consumo inerenti i mezzi di trasporto utilizzati nell’attività di impresa, arti e professioni. Analizzando in modo completo l’ordinamento tributario sugli autoveicoli, il volume guida il lettore nella gestione fiscale di un bene la cui amministrazione non è sempre facile. In particolare, il volume analizza il trattamento degli autoveicoli a deducibilità integrale, a deducibilità limitata, utilizzati dagli agenti e rappresentanti e dagli esercenti arti e professioni, oltre alla nuova disciplina IVA, al nuovo “F24 auto UE”, così come modificato dal Provvedimento dell’Agenzia delle Entrate del 29 marzo 2010. Vengono affrontate le novità su ammortamenti, leasing e interessi passivi, la cessione degli autoveicoli, l'autovettura concessa al dipendente, amministratore o collaboratore. Le problematiche trattate abbracciano la casistica più ampia: approvvigionamento degli autoveicoli (acquisto, noleggio, leasing), l’imposizione indiretta, l’accertamento nel settore auto, il fermo amministrativo e le operazioni intracomunitarie.

This is the thirtieth volume in the series How Ottawa Spends. It is arguable that never in these years have Canadians faced such serious economic upheaval and political dysfunction as the current climate. The dramatic and seemingly sudden changes in the economy occurred simultaneously with a political drama - one that was largely disassociated from the real and pressing economic challenge. Early Harper budgets delivered lower taxes for all Canadians partly through highly targeted but politically noticeable small tax breaks on textbooks for students, tools for apprentices in skilled trades, and public transit costs. The needs of the beleaguered average Canadian and the "swing voter in the swing constituencies" of an already strategized "next" election were a key part of Conservative agenda-setting. In the 2007 budget alone there were twenty-nine separate tax reductions and federal spending was projected to increase by $10 billion, including a 5.7 percent increase in program spending. A small surplus of $3.3 billion was planned, almost all of which would go to debt reduction. As Harper savoured his 14 October 2008 re-election with a strengthened minority government, although without his desired majority, he and his minister of Finance already knew that his surpluses were likely gone in the face of the crashing financial sector and a looming recession. Why Britain’s attempt at small government proved unable to cope with the challenges of the modern world In the nineteenth century, as Britain attained a leading economic and political position in Europe, British policymakers embarked on a bold experiment with small and limited government. By the outbreak of the First World War, however, this laissez-faire philosophy of government had been abandoned and the country had taken its first steps toward becoming a modern welfare state. This book tells the story of Britain’s laissez-faire experiment, examining why it was done, how it functioned, and why it was ultimately rejected in favor of a more interventionist form of governance. Blending insights from modern economic theory with a wealth of historical evidence, W. Walker Hanlon traces the slow expansion of government intervention across a broad spectrum of government functions in order to understand why and how Britain gave up on laissez-faire. It was not abandoned because Britain’s leaders lost faith in small government as some have suggested, nor did it collapse under the growing influence of working-class political power. Instead, Britain’s move away from small government was a pragmatic and piecemeal response—by policymakers who often deeply believed in laissez-faire—to the economic forces unleashed by the Industrial Revolution.
